"Getting in and Out of Trouble" - 3rd Edition

With training and travel budgets cuts, operators and managers are not able to add to their experience and knowledge of treament plant operations.This 1-day workshop focuses on recent happenings and experiences in treatment plant operations. Many plants have found new ways to get into trouble. Some of these plants found solutions, some did not. Some treatment plants have found and implemented new approaches to operating with on-line instrumentation, modifying process and so on. There is a lot of material to cover in this jam packed 1-day workshop.
Workshop Topics:
- Optimizing treatment capacity and eliminating sludge quality problems by implementing step feed - expand capacity, reduce overload, eliminate underloads, control foams and filaments
- Selectors - Good or Bad
- Foam - 'The Continuing Problem"
- On-Line instruments Update - DO, TOC, COD, ammonia, phosphate, sludge beds - Do they work?
- Non filamentous sludge Quality Problems - causes and solutions
- Controlling Filamentous Sludge Bulking - Update on types causes, controls - short and long term
- Potpourri: Special topics based on attendee input
- ASB Troubles - review and discussion of current problems and cures
